Strategies for Success
Maximizing your experience with Activity 5 involves the adoption of effective strategies. Here are some strategies to ensure your success:
1. Set Clear Learning Goals
Before diving into your review, define what you want to achieve. Setting clear, actionable objectives can help guide your process and keep you focused.
2. Engage with Multimedia Resources
Utilizing various resources such as videos, blogs, and interactive tools can enrich your understanding. Platforms like Khan Academy offer great supplementary content to visualize concepts.
3. Foster a Study Group
Studying in a group can offer diverse perspectives on the attempted derivations. Group discussions can highlight different interpretations, enhancing comprehension.
4. Utilize Feedback Effectively
When reviewing your attempted derivations, pay close attention to feedback from instructors or peers. Use this information as a learning opportunity to refine your techniques and address any misunderstandings.
5. Practice, Practice, Practice
The more you practice, the more proficient you become. Engaging regularly with derivation concepts strengthens your grasp and boosts your confidence in applying them.
Common Challenges and Solutions
Understanding derivations can come with challenges. Here are some common obstacles students may face along with solutions to overcome them:
1. Difficulty in Understanding Concepts
Many students struggle to fully grasp some derivation principles. To combat this, break down complex ideas into smaller, manageable parts and use analogies or real-world examples to illustrate them.
2. Lack of Engagement
Feeling disengaged with material can hinder learning. Incorporate active learning techniques such as teaching the material to someone else or applying it to real-life situations to enhance retention.
3. Time Management
With numerous responsibilities competing for your attention, managing your study time effectively can be tough. Create a structured schedule prioritizing your study sessions specifically for Activity 5 to ensure adequate time is dedicated to it.
4. Anxiety about Performance
Performance anxiety can impact learning. Practicing mindfulness or relaxation techniques can be beneficial. Approaching learning with a growth mindset—viewing mistakes as learning opportunities—can also alleviate stress.
